Thanks everyone for their patience - some pics at last! As you can see, the most important parts of the kit are there - bracket, pulleys and the supercharger unit. Pipework to come obviously (CAI to s/c, s/c to existing pipework), and the belt needs to be put on, but with those in place, it's tune and away!
To clarify, this is not my car, but it is the first customer car being used at the prototype mule for the kit. I've been told two more weeks or so to finish it off and it'll move into production.
